Block

#19,159,962
Block Number
19,159,962 @ 07/28/2024, 24:48:00
Status
Finalized
ID
0x01245b9af71240a9b189df7a8cdf15d280565d5ab2d8b525567b8608e20ed967
Transactions
Gas Used
20882756/40000000 (52.21% Used)
Total Score
1,868,000,371 (+100)
Rewards
62.65 VTHO